I think the reason why Hamilton is a big city with a small city feel is b/c our downtown lacks major retailers. We don't even have a grocery store in the core!! Just the Farmer's Market (which is great, just not always open).
Some people find this charming. Most (such as myself) find it inconvenient as I have to travel some distance, mostly to the suburbs, to shop. I live downtown, and the Core (which Flar mostly covered in this thread) is only a 7-9 min walk from my condo.
Our Economic Development Dept is (apparently) aggressively courting "major" retail tenants to locate in our core. Some show interest but with hesitation despite the huge amount of residential units in the entire downtown area. Starbucks is actually JUST opening it's 1st Downtown Hamilton location on Locke Street South.
So things are going to turn around, slowly but surely re: major Retail tenants downtown.
